logo

Output 84896cf4108465c8718a8f5ec6c34b6d609e4594e3ddc5e0483a7b045399e93a:1

value
1025748263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d5edb3c37bb7bfd82a28aeb594f4dfbb9c2cb89 OP_EQUALVERIFY OP_CHECKSIG
address
1DtVunZEM2NceTmC3iPemD2cexDeYLBMjC
transaction
84896cf4108465c8718a8f5ec6c34b6d609e4594e3ddc5e0483a7b045399e93a